Passive 3D is the only 3D I can tolerate and find enjoyable. Active shutter 3D gave me headaches and eyestrain because of the flickering from the shutter. With passive 3D there is none of that, so I don't get those symptoms. It's one the reasons why I can see why 3D didn't do as well.
